摘要
Based on the characteristics of strong-inertia and far time lag and strong coupling, uncertainly nonlinear multi-parameter air-conditioning system is difficult to be described with accurate mathematical model. this paper combines the predictive optimum ideas and the neural networks character, which can accurately describe a nonlinear and uncertain dynamic process and proposes a model that can predict the load by artificial neural networks Using real data and L-M optimized method to train the neural networks and conduct the pseudo-real-time simulation the result indicates that this method is a new and reliable way for predicting the dynamic load efficiently and accurately in real time.
